Burned Out


Day by day

Night by Night

I can't continue in this mental fight

 

Do you know how hard it is?

Do you know what it's about,

To constantly feel like a cigarette put out?

 

My fire is out

I am nothing but smoke

it seeps through my cracks until I begin to choke.

 

I am at war.

I have little power

to continue this mental battle from minute to hour

 

My will to win is gone,

I have no more might

How do you fight it,

when the "it" is what you're using to fight?
